by adrian |There’s two ways to do multiple exposure on your original russian LOMO LC-A.
A. Simple tweak:
- Take a shot.
- Push the button on the bottom right as if to rewind the film (camera back facing you).
- Move the advance wheel as if to advance to the next frame.
- Take another shot. The pictures will overlap (double expose).
- Repeat steps 1-4 for multiple exposures.

B. Adding a multiple exposure button/ switch to your LC-A similar like the LC-A+. This one requires surgery on your camera. Pls do it at your OWN RISK!

by adrian |What I’m about the reveal may spoil some lomography fun but if you haven’t heard from somewhere yet, you might as well hear it from here right?

Yes we know the digi hari has no live view and the effect are pretty much random. What if I told you that you can on the live view and also control the effects to your liking? keke… it’s cool but like I said it will ruin the lomography fun. So pls try it at your OWN RISK!

Step 1: Off your Digital Harinezumi
Step 2: Press and hold the shutter button, while holding power-up the Digital Harinezumi to enter R/B setting. It should state the software version and then give you two numbers – R:256 and B:256.
Step 3: Using the “menu” and “ok” buttons you can now change the R: number to change the red colour balance. By sliding the “slider” button you can switch between the red (R:) or blue (B:) values. You can try whatever colour combination that you like thru trail and error. In this mode, Live View isn’t turned-off!
Step 4: Just turn off the camera to reset the settings back to default!
